Lines Matching refs:base
57 void __iomem *base;
214 return gpio->base + bank->val_regs + GPIO_VAL_VALUE;
216 return gpio->base + bank->rdata_reg;
218 return gpio->base + bank->val_regs + GPIO_VAL_DIR;
220 return gpio->base + bank->irq_regs + GPIO_IRQ_ENABLE;
222 return gpio->base + bank->irq_regs + GPIO_IRQ_TYPE0;
224 return gpio->base + bank->irq_regs + GPIO_IRQ_TYPE1;
226 return gpio->base + bank->irq_regs + GPIO_IRQ_TYPE2;
228 return gpio->base + bank->irq_regs + GPIO_IRQ_STATUS;
230 return gpio->base + bank->debounce_regs + GPIO_DEBOUNCE_SEL1;
232 return gpio->base + bank->debounce_regs + GPIO_DEBOUNCE_SEL2;
234 return gpio->base + bank->tolerance_regs;
236 return gpio->base + bank->cmdsrc_regs + GPIO_CMDSRC_0;
238 return gpio->base + bank->cmdsrc_regs + GPIO_CMDSRC_1;
746 return pinctrl_gpio_request(chip->base + offset);
751 pinctrl_gpio_free(chip->base + offset);
874 cycles = ioread32(gpio->base + debounce_timers[i]);
910 iowrite32(requested_cycles, gpio->base + debounce_timers[i]);
969 return pinctrl_gpio_set_config(chip->base + offset, config);
1150 gpio->base = devm_platform_ioremap_resource(pdev, 0);
1151 if (IS_ERR(gpio->base))
1152 return PTR_ERR(gpio->base);
1183 gpio->chip.base = -1;